Block Details
Soulstone blocks: 0.7 friction, Diamond Pickaxe breaks them faster. Found in Soulstone Caves more commonly. 10000 Resistance. Not destructible by explosion, 50.0 breaking time without a tool, 3 light emission, 15 light dampening. Sound is stone + soul sand together. Crafted with pure Basic Souls and stone.
